Synthesis of New Iminocoumarins Bearing Parabanic Moieties
摘要:
[image omitted] The synthesis of novel substituted 3-p-nitro-phenyliminocoumarins and corresponding N-ureaiminocoumarins is described. The condensation of these materials with oxalyl chloride leads to the corresponding N-parabanic iminocoumarins, which have not previously been described, in moderate or good yields and high selectivity. The structures were characterized by Fourier transform infrared, 1H and 13C NMR, and elemental analysis.
